Transaction d3aa584a7557a9b603615fdd49203d416ca6dc66bdff26e7f09214e868291255
1 Input
1 Output
-
d3aa584a7557a9b603615fdd49203d416ca6dc66bdff26e7f09214e868291255:0
- value
- 2781837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ba5e21c840fdef090abf7293b612316147638af OP_EQUALVERIFY OP_CHECKSIG
- address
- 13XBxx5Cwb44zn25WNxyZjcNamQjkVRusr